TWO late strikes gave Bromsgrove Rovers Reserves a 2-0 home victory over Rushall Olympic.
Last Saturday's result at the Victoria Ground gives Rovers the double over Rushall and keep them third in the Midland Combination reserve division.
Rovers stepped up the pace in the second half with Richard Langford grabbing the opening goal with 15 minutes left. The second was bundled in by Mark Smith after a penalty area tangle.
The Reserves lost 2-0 at home to Alvechurch in the Worcestershire Senior Urn semi-final on Tuesday, February 17.
